Free Press sports writers and columnists predict the Detroit Lions' season opener against the New York Jets on Monday Night Football. Check out our season predictions, including the playoffs.
Carlos Monarrez
Lions 27, Jets 20: The Lions’ revamped run game will give their offense even more fire power. Their defense will give up ground yards to Bilal Powell and Isaiah Crowell, but rookie QB Sam Darnold won’t be able to make much happen in the air.
